Stock ScreenerStock IdeasGrowth At A Reasonable Price
High Earnings Growth at a Reasonable Price
Companies with a track record of high earnings growth with good valuation scores

Valuation Score: >= 50
Earnings Growth Y/Y: High
Earnings Growth 5Y: High
Ticker
Company
Market Cap
Price
Price Target
Upside/Downside
Top Analysts Upside/Downside
Consensus
Top Analysts Consensus
Analysts
Top Analysts
Fore. Revenue Growth
Fore. Earnings Growth
Forecast ROE
Forecast ROA
ESOA
ENERGY SERVICES OF AMERICA CORP
$178.21M$10.66$21.0097.00%Strong Buy1N/AN/A12.43%3.93%
VRNT
VERINT SYSTEMS INC
$1.03B$17.17$28.0063.08%Buy45.87%44.70%17.30%6.85%
BMRN
BIOMARIN PHARMACEUTICAL INC
$10.78B$56.22$95.7870.36%Strong Buy99.05%23.96%N/AN/A
DSWL
DESWELL INDUSTRIES INC
$36.57M$2.30N/AN/AN/AN/AN/AN/AN/AN/A
AEHR
AEHR TEST SYSTEMS
$337.01M$11.32N/AN/AN/AN/A16.95%N/A-0.24%-0.20%
CAMT
CAMTEK LTD
$3.21B$70.33$90.8829.21%Strong Buy87.14%5.81%26.53%16.70%
SIEB
SIEBERT FINANCIAL CORP
$183.87M$4.55N/AN/AN/AN/AN/AN/AN/AN/A
MCY
MERCURY GENERAL CORP
$3.57B$64.49$80.0024.05%Strong Buy15.07%N/A15.97%3.22%
AMS
AMERICAN SHARED HOSPITAL SERVICES
$15.29M$2.37N/AN/AN/AN/AN/AN/AN/AN/A
GASS
STEALTHGAS INC
$240.43M$6.73N/AN/AN/AN/AN/AN/AN/AN/A
BCS
BARCLAYS PLC
$62.19B$17.38N/AN/AN/AN/A4.57%14.61%44.31%2.08%
ESP
ESPEY MFG & ELECTRONICS CORP
$115.75M$40.88N/AN/AN/AN/AN/AN/AN/AN/A
PNRG
PRIMEENERGY RESOURCES CORP
$242.86M$146.26N/AN/AN/AN/AN/AN/AN/AN/A
NL
NL INDUSTRIES INC
$330.70M$6.77N/AN/AN/AN/AN/AN/AN/AN/A
POWL
POWELL INDUSTRIES INC
$2.27B$187.85N/AN/AN/AN/A2.63%-1.73%33.17%18.60%
UAL
UNITED AIRLINES HOLDINGS INC
$24.17B$74.00$103.6440.05%Strong Buy115.32%8.08%N/AN/A
COKE
COCA-COLA CONSOLIDATED INC
$9.47B$108.62N/AN/AN/AN/AN/AN/AN/AN/A
ATLC
ATLANTICUS HOLDINGS CORP
$770.53M$50.94$66.0029.56%Buy2233.89%-4.28%21.61%3.52%
QCOM
QUALCOMM INC
$169.88B$154.72$179.5016.02%Buy141.02%-2.25%N/AN/A
GOOGL
ALPHABET INC
$2.12T$174.67$197.5213.08%Buy293.61%8.60%47.90%34.79%
GHC
GRAHAM HOLDINGS CO
$4.09B$938.78N/AN/AN/AN/AN/AN/AN/AN/A
DGII
DIGI INTERNATIONAL INC
$1.23B$33.05$37.5013.46%Buy22.42%23.65%10.66%8.26%
TXRH
TEXAS ROADHOUSE INC
$12.09B$182.29$189.203.79%Buy158.07%9.22%42.42%18.35%
HRTG
HERITAGE INSURANCE HOLDINGS INC
$713.16M$23.01$29.0026.03%Strong Buy22.11%27.76%34.62%5.15%
SGU
STAR GROUP LP
$401.66M$11.62N/AN/AN/AN/AN/AN/AN/AN/A
ENVA
ENOVA INTERNATIONAL INC
$2.37B$93.32$132.4041.88%Strong Buy594.48%20.36%26.36%5.78%
SELF
GLOBAL SELF STORAGE INC
$63.27M$5.58N/AN/AN/AN/AN/AN/AN/AN/A
NXST
NEXSTAR MEDIA GROUP INC
$5.02B$166.54$206.6724.09%Strong Buy6-0.20%3.06%52.56%10.35%
MGYR
MAGYAR BANCORP INC
$102.69M$15.87N/AN/AN/AN/AN/AN/AN/AN/A
AUDC
AUDIOCODES LTD
$262.80M$8.90$11.6731.09%Hold31.11%0.86%N/AN/A
CLW
CLEARWATER PAPER CORP
$447.52M$27.53$37.0034.40%Buy1N/AN/AN/AN/A
XYF
X FINANCIAL
$778.21M$18.40N/AN/AN/AN/AN/AN/AN/AN/A
NHC
NATIONAL HEALTHCARE CORP
$1.60B$103.10N/AN/AN/AN/AN/AN/AN/AN/A
GPN
GLOBAL PAYMENTS INC
$18.20B$74.62$105.4341.29%Buy14-1.35%45.48%16.09%7.52%
ARCB
ARCBEST CORP
$1.56B$68.10$88.4029.81%Buy104.42%3.50%21.96%11.81%
QFIN
QIFU TECHNOLOGY INC
$5.61B$41.69$52.7026.41%Strong Buy17.01%11.59%81.07%33.61%
NNI
NELNET INC
$4.09B$112.45N/AN/AN/AN/AN/A44.61%9.04%2.18%
PSIX
POWER SOLUTIONS INTERNATIONAL INC
$1.15B$49.93N/AN/AN/AN/AN/AN/AN/AN/A
FSLR
FIRST SOLAR INC
$18.79B$175.20$225.5728.75%Strong Buy2314.37%33.76%39.30%26.55%
MSB
MESABI TRUST
$337.18M$25.70N/AN/AN/AN/AN/AN/AN/AN/A
ISSC
INNOVATIVE SOLUTIONS & SUPPORT INC
$222.52M$12.64N/AN/AN/AN/A13.07%-0.00%23.03%13.71%
PPC
PILGRIMS PRIDE CORP
$10.94B$46.14$48.004.03%Hold1N/A5.59%35.95%10.27%
RNGR
RANGER ENERGY SERVICES INC
$289.10M$12.85N/AN/AN/AN/AN/AN/A12.30%8.90%
BCO
BRINKS CO
$3.54B$84.28N/AN/AN/AN/A2.38%94.44%176.12%5.51%
CPRX
CATALYST PHARMACEUTICALS INC
$2.87B$23.53$32.5038.12%Strong Buy410.42%16.72%40.85%35.70%
AZN
ASTRAZENECA PLC
$230.70B$74.42N/AN/AN/AN/A-1.62%31.12%22.17%8.56%
AES
AES CORP
$8.14B$11.44$12.004.90%Buy64.46%8.52%50.29%3.59%
NRIM
NORTHRIM BANCORP INC
$481.97M$87.30N/AN/AN/AN/A19.80%26.44%19.44%1.73%
WEX
WEX INC
$4.71B$137.65$161.1417.07%Hold71.73%35.40%68.71%3.99%
GNW
GENWORTH FINANCIAL INC
$2.88B$6.95$8.5022.30%Hold1N/AN/AN/AN/A
CHCI
COMSTOCK HOLDING COMPANIES INC
$100.88M$10.02N/AN/AN/AN/AN/AN/AN/AN/A
CX
CEMEX SAB DE CV
$9.82B$6.77$7.023.65%Hold32.18%91.50%86.98%38.79%
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.